(CHAI) reported a Q4 2025 loss per share of -$8.15, far below the consensus estimate of -$1.55 — a negative surprise of 425.67%. The company did not disclose any revenue figures for the quarter. Despite the steep earnings miss, the stock rose 5.41% in after-hours trading, possibly reflecting investor focus on long-term AI development prospects rather than near-term financial results.

This makes it easier to analyze multiple markets simultaneously. CHAI’s Q4 2025 results underscore the capital-intensive nature of the AI industry. The reported net loss of -$8.15 per share more than quintupled the expected deficit, suggesting higher-than-anticipated operating expenses, possibly from accelerated R&D spending on next-generation language models, cloud infrastructure, or talent acquisition. The absence of reported revenue remains a significant concern; the company may be in a pre-revenue stage or chose not to disclose segment breakdowns. Operating margins likely deteriorated severely, as fixed costs and investment outlays outpaced any potential revenue streams. The cash burn rate appears to have intensified, raising questions about the company’s runway. Management may have prioritized scaling technology and data centers over short-term profitability, a common strategy among early-stage AI firms. However, the magnitude of the earnings surprise indicates that either costs were underestimated or operational setbacks occurred, such as delayed product launches or higher than expected compute costs. Without clear revenue visibility, investors are forced to rely on non-financial milestones to gauge progress. Looking ahead, CHAI management may provide guidance that focuses on non-GAAP metrics or operational targets rather than traditional revenue forecasts. The company could anticipate narrowing losses as it begins to commercialize its AI platforms, possibly through licensing, API access, or enterprise contracts. Strategic priorities likely include expanding the capabilities of its core AI models, forming partnerships with cloud providers, and securing additional financing to fund ongoing R&D. Risk factors include the potential for continued high cash burn, competitive pressure from well-funded rivals, and regulatory uncertainty around AI safety standards. The stock’s positive reaction despite the massive miss suggests that some investors may view the quarter as an expected investment phase. However, if the company fails to demonstrate a credible path to revenue generation within the next few quarters, sentiment could sour. The lack of revenue disclosure also creates opacity, making it difficult to assess unit economics or customer traction. The 5.41% stock uptick following the earnings release is counterintuitive given the severe EPS miss. This may reflect short covering, a low float, or belief that the worst is behind CHAI. Analyst views are likely mixed: some may defend the heavy spending as necessary for long-term competitiveness, while others could downgrade the stock due to widening losses and no revenue visibility. Key watchpoints for the next quarter include any first-time revenue disclosure, gross margin commentary, cash balance updates, and management’s timeline to profitability. Investors should also monitor cash burn rate and any dilutive financing announcements. The company’s ability to convert AI advancements into commercial contracts will be critical. Without a revenue catalyst, the stock remains highly speculative and sensitive to sentiment shifts.
